Karrow Plumbing and Heating
renovation · Sanitary fitter
114 N Division Ave, 61064 Polorenovation · Sanitary fitter
114 N Division Ave, 61064 Polorenovation · Sanitary fitter
509 S Locust St, 61030 Forrestonrenovation · Sanitary fitter
104 E Main St, 61030 Forrestonrenovation · Sanitary fitter
39 Palmyra Rd, 61081 Sterlingrenovation · Sanitary fitter
7982 S Il Route 2, 61021 Dixonrenovation · Sanitary fitter
608 Depot Ave, 61021 Dixonrenovation · Sanitary fitter
24079 Fulfs Rd, 61081 Sterlingrenovation · Sanitary fitter
330 E Franklin St, 61046 Lanarkrenovation · Sanitary fitter
1398 Harmon Rd, 61021 Dixon